This print showcases Gustav Klimt's iconic masterpiece, "Portrait of Adele Bloch-Bauer II" painted in 1912. The oil on canvas artwork measures an impressive 190x120 cm and is currently held in a private collection. Previously part of the Osterreichische Galerie Belvedere in Vienna until 2006, it was returned to the heirs of its pre-World War II owner and subsequently sold at auction. The portrait depicts Adele Bloch-Bauer, a society beauty from the early 20th century. Standing gracefully amidst a vibrant floral backdrop, she exudes elegance and style with her fashionable hat and exquisite gown. This symbolist artwork embodies the Viennese Secession movement, characterized by its modern artistic style known as Jugendstil or Art Nouveau. With its bright colors and meticulous attention to detail, this painting represents a significant piece of Austrian art history. Its restitution adds another layer of complexity to its story, highlighting the impact of World War II on cultural heritage.
